Getting Started: Basic Requirements

  • Age: You must be at least 13 years old to volunteer with out Cat Care program. Volunteers under 18 must be accompanied by a trained parent or guardian (21+) at all times.

  • Expectations: We ask volunteers to commit to at least 30 hours per year of volunteer service with PAWS. This translates to a minimum of one shift per month.

  • Documentation: All volunteers must Complete an Application, sign a Code of Conduct, and complete online training as well as attend in-person mentor sessions.

Choose Your Path

We offer three primary routes for new volunteers to get involved immediately:

1. Cat Care 

  • Daily Tasks: Feeding, cleaning living areas, scooping litter boxes, doing laundry, and cat socialization.

  • Growth: Train to become a Cat Adoption Helper VolunteerCat Adoption Counselor, or Cat Shift Leader.

2. Dog Care 

  • Daily Tasks: Walking dogs, feeding and watering, and generally providing enrichment and exercise for our dogs.

  • Growth: Level up to Dog Adoption Counselor or Dog Shift Leader.

3. Front Desk 

  • Daily Tasks: Greeting visitors, answering phones, processing donations, and completing important administrative projects.

  • Impact: You are the face of PAWS, playing a vital role in assisting community members and animals in need.
